Money
Example 1:
RM 54 285 – RM 46 776 ÷ 8 =
Solution :
RM 54 285 – RM 46 776 ÷ 8
= RM 54 285 – RM 5 847
= RM 48 438
Example 2 :
RM 58.35 + RM 4.50 – (RM 14.80 + 65 sen) =
Solution :
RM 58.35 + RM 4.50 – (RM 14.80 + 65 sen)
= RM 58.35 + RM 4.50 – RM 15.45
= RM 62.85 – RM 15.45
= RM 47.40
Example 3 :
The diagram shows the cost price of a watch. Zaki gets a discount of RM1.90 on each watch.
How much does he have to pay for 20 watches?
20 × (RM 29.90 – RM 1.90)
= 20 × RM 28
= RM 560
Zaki has to pay RM 560 for 20 watches.
